What do you need to change before you take your ITR to the track?
Hi guys,
Newbie to track days
Apart from the obvious like racing pads and an extra set of tyres what else will i need to change before I take my teg on the tracks? people have suggested that I fit a Honda Logo oil filter ( because the logo filter is smaller it filter oil more finely apparently? :S)

About the only thing you would really want to change is to make sure you have some fresh brake fluid and maybe some upgraded/performance front pads.
Fresh oil would be nice, but more importantly make sure you check it a couple times during the day and add some (maybe overfill a half litre) until you see if you'll be burning any when on the track for the first couple sessions.
Tires and the rest of the stuff are things to consider in the future depending on how much you enjoy driving on track, how fast you want to go and whether or not you want to get better and go faster as time goes on.

If you haven't changed your clutch fluid in some years, you should go ahead and change that as well. Just replace it with whatever high performance brake fluid you're going to use.

Years? Haha the owners manual says to check it frequently, it goes bad faster than the brake fluid (not including track events
).
Bring an extra set of front rotors, coolant, oil, tools, a jack, stands, duct tape, zip ties, a helmet
